A few quick things just off the top of my head.
The colors....great!!
The EQ fly-out with spectrum analyzing....great!!
I have been comping guitar tracks to get a feel for the new way that this works....Great!!
I installed a new VST and forgot to shutdown X3 while doing it. A window popped up and it re-scanned without me telling it to....great!!
In X2 I had a few graphical glitches from time to time. Not in X3 at this point. Hopefully they are gone for good.
The new way that your plugins are sorted.....spectacular!!!

In the area of minor but appreciated and unexpected improvements. One of my project templates is quite big. Loads of VSTi's and preloaded samples. X3 loads it at around 60% of the time X2 does. It could just be a random fluke of course and only valid for this one. But I did time it. Would be interesting if others notice the same.
